Answer:
x=6 y=-9
Step-by-step explanation:
- Layer the equations on each other as you would in a subtraction problem:
8x + 2y=30
7x + 2y=24
- Subtract the equation just like you would normally. This should leave 1x=6 or x=6.
- Now that you have your x value, plug it in as x for one of the equations. For the 2nd equation, this leaves:
42+2y=24 then
2y=-18 then
y=-9
- Double check your y value by plugging x=6 into the first equation. This should also leave y=-9.
